The Nuclear Power Plant is an alternative to the Solar Array for producing Energy. It consumes Hydrogen from your Hydrogen Synthesizer in order to make extra power.

Nuclear Power Plants create more energy as you level up your Energy Tech.

Costs

Ore Cost = ceiling(500 * 1.8^Level)

Crystal Cost = ceiling(200 * 1.8^Level)

Hydrogen Cost = ceiling(100 * 1.8^Level)

Specs

Production

The formula for energy production is:

Energy = 30 x Level x (1.05 + Energy Tech Level x 0.01)Level

Hydrogen Consumption

Hydrogen = 10 x Level x 1.1Level is the actual formula used...

Efficiency

The efficiency of Nuclear Power Plants decreases with each level of the plant until Energy Tech Level 5. After Energy Tech Level 5, efficiency improves with each level of the plant.

Requirements

Hydrogen Synthesizer Level 5

Energy Tech Level 3

Note

As a Nuclear power plant uses hydrogen to generate energy it may be wise to check that you are not running it at 100% output and producing extra energy that is not being used/needed. e.g. if you have 100 extra energy, turn your power plant down, to stop "wasting" hydrogen generating unneeded energy. The saving may be small, but why use it if you do not have to?
